Windows 8 Release Preview will be out in the first week of June, Microsoft stated at Windows 8 Dev Days event in Japan. Release Preview will be the next major pre-launch version of Windows 8 from the company after it released Consumer Preview in February.

Release Preview is expected to be more stable and will be closer to the final build, which is expected to ship in October this year.

This news comes fresh out of Microsoft's announcement of Windows 8 Editions last week, which will include Windows 8, Pro, Enterprise and RT (for ARM processors).

There are no other details available right now about the release.
